Tutorial Membuat Splashscreen Menggunakan Android Studio

Tutorial Membuat Splashscreen Menggunakan Android Studio

Assalamuallaikum Wr. Wb.
Hai guys ketemu lagi dengan saya hayda herawati. Kali ini saya ingin membuat tutorial splashscreen. sebelum kita masuk ke materinya. kalian udah pernah denger Splashscreen???
Splash screen merupakan tampilan tambahan yang muncul saat pertama kali kita membuka suatu aplikasi. Splash Screen ini biasanya digunakan untuk “Branding” dari pemilik aplikasi tersebut.
Langsung aja kita masuk ke materinya.

1. Buat Main Activity baru yang bernama "SplashScreen". Setelah mainactivitynya dibuat lalu buat atur xmlnya. Dipostingan saya sebelumnya kita telah membuat layout, mulai dari cara memasukan gambar, tulisan dan lain sebagainya. kemudian kita buat lagi bagian- bagian tersebut.
2. Setelah dibagian Xml tersebut selesai dibuat, kita akan masuk dibagian java dibagian ini kita akan mengatur atau membuat prosesnya. didalamnya kita menggunakan proggres bar, jadi kita akan mengatur sedemikian rupa, di dalam java terdapat pengaturan waktu splashscreen berjalan. 
@Overrideprotected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.activity_splash_screen);
    rolling = (ProgressBar) findViewById(R.id.rolling);

    Thread thread = new Thread(new Runnable() {
        @Override        public void run() {
            try{
                Thread.sleep(3000); // Waktu Pnding 3 Detik            }catch(InterruptedException ex){
                ex.printStackTrace();
            }finally {
                startActivity(new Intent(SplashScreen.this,hal_layout.class));
                finish();
            }
        }
    });
    thread.start();
}

3. Setelah Java dan Xmlnya selesai kita atur bagian manifestnya, dibagian ini kita akan mengatur splashscreen supaya berjalan.
<application    android:allowBackup="true"    android:icon="@mipmap/ic_launcher"    android:label="@string/app_name"    android:supportsRtl="true"    android:theme="@style/AppTheme">
    <activity        android:name=".SplashScreen">
    <intent-filter>
        <action android:name="android.intent.action.MAIN" />

        <category android:name="android.intent.category.LAUNCHER" />
    </intent-filter>
</activity>
    <activity android:name=".hal_layout"> </activity>

    <activity android:name=".Tampil_layout" > </activity>

</application>


4. Kemudian saya mencoba untuk merunning nya dan dibawah ini adalah hasilnya.


Membuat Splashscreen mudah bukan, kalian bisa mencobanya di laptop kalian masing- masing:) semoga bisa membantu. sampai jumpa di postingan selanjutnya.
23.10
22/02/2018
Hayda Herawati





Comments

Popular posts from this blog

Struktur Basis Data (konsep basis data) Dan Diagram ERD

Sistem alur Pembuatan Aplikasi Ticketing Pesawat Terbang dan Kereta Api

membuat Desain aplikasi menggunakan aplikasi pencil